@@baxterclagmoar9333 Pretty much any Australian bank. I’m with Commonwealth but it doesn’t really matter, they're required by law to assist you with this. If you pay for a service and they don’t fulfill their end of the bargain they’re liable, they can write all they want on the “agreement” contract that they’re not liable etc, but that doesn’t matter. Just make sure that when you contact the support you keep your cool and be reasonable. Follow these steps: • Your first email must be asking for an alternative flight that’s free and accommodating. They’ll refuse. • Ask for a refund as they did not offer a service nor a free alternative. They’ll refuse again. • They tell you that if you start a refund process with them, it’ll take a month or two and you can only get half of your money back. Or even nothing. NEVER AGREE. • State that you’re unsatisfied with this process and you’ll start charging back with the bank. • Now contact your bank, with Commonwealth it’s all via chat in the app. Email your grievance then attach your support emails + flight receipt. • Ten days later: money back. Remember you need to show the bank that you tried and exhausted all your options but Qantas still wants to fk you. That should be it.
